The Rawl Frame Fixing M10x80 (50) is a high-performance universal fixing designed for installing timber, steel, metal, or PVC window and door frames. Suitable for high-load applications, it delivers reliable fastening in concrete, brick, clay, hollow brick, and aerated concrete. Manufactured from tough PA6.6 nylon for durability, it features multi-axis expansion for a secure hold and an embedment depth mark for accurate installation. The fixing is compatible with both TX countersunk and hex head designs, with a TX40 drive allowing a single bit to be used across all types for added convenience.
